ISDN is short for Integrated Service Digital Network and can be described as a communication system that simultaneously allows voice, video and data services to be delivered over digital lines.
As part of a trend amongst telecoms providers around the world, in 2015, BT announced it would be phasing out its ISDN networks over the course of five years, ending in 2025 and you will no longer be able to purchase additional ISDN lines after September 2023.
Businesses have therefore been advised not to renew any existing ISDN network contracts and to instead invest in alternative telephone and communication solutions that can support their future growth plans.
